STADIUM SECURITY SCREENING ADVISORY


In conjunction with the recently announced elevated security standards across all 20 Major League Soccer venues, the Chicago Fire will introduce random security screening of fans entering Toyota Park beginning on Saturday, April 30 when the Fire host D.C. United (4 p.m. CT, CSN Chicago).


The random screenings will be conducted with hand-held metal detectors. All fans are advised to allow extra time for stadium entry in an effort to alleviate lines at stadium gates and minimize inconveniences.

    I-55 and IL 171


    The Illinois Department of Transportation (IDOT) announced that lane reductions and ramp closures are necessary for a bridge reconstruction project along Illinois 171 and the Interstate 55 interchange beginning March 21. The project will reconstruct the bridges along northbound Illinois 171 from 47th Street to 55th Street as well as the interchange with Interstate 55.


    In order to complete the work, traffic on Illinois 171 will be reduced to one lane in each direction, beginning March 24. Traffic will shift onto the newly constructed southbound lanes on Illinois 171. There will be occasional, overnight closures on Interstate 55 near Illinois 171 and permanent shoulder closures on I-55 at IL 171.


    As of March 28, all ramps on northbound IL 171 are closed to traffic in order to reconstruct the interchange. Detours will be posted for the following permanent ramp closures:


    Northbound I-55 to Northbound IL 171
    Southbound I-55 to Northbound IL 171
    Northbound IL 171 to Northbound I-55
    Northbound IL 171 to Southbound I-55
    Northbound IL 171 to Joliet Road
